Okay, so at this point we should probably talk a little bit about privacy. One of the things that sets the Kik Messenger app apart from some of the other instant messaging platforms around is the privacy it guarantees its users. You see, other similar platforms require their users to display their real names or even, as is the case with the hugely popular app WhatsApp, require them not only to provide their telephone number but also to share it with other users in order to be able to chat with them.
The Kik Messenger app, however, is different because all it requires their users to share with one another is a unique user name of their choice. Your user name is what identifies you to other members. If someone wants to find you on Kik Messenger, they will have to know you user name and search for it. Your display name is what would then be shown on the screen of anyone chatting to you. There is, of course, no reason why your user name and your display name could not be exactly the same. As there is also no reason why they should be something completely different. This is all up to you. The only issue here is while your display name could be absolutely anything you choose, your user name has to be unique to you, so you would be limited, so to speak, to user names no one has picked out yet.
The great thing about all of this is that you can protect your privacy and real identity behind any name you choose. If you want your existing friends to find you on the Kik Messenger app, you would have three different options:
- You could simply let them know your full user name so they can type it in in the search box. Just be sure to spell it out correctly or else your friends may end up chatting with someone else with a user name similar (but obviously not identical) to yours.
- You could instead share your Kik code with your friends so they can scan it with their mobile devices and that way add you to their chats lists.
- Finally, if you turn on the “address book matching” feature in your settings, any of your contacts who also uses the Kik Messenger app and has the same feature turned on as well, would be automatically added to your chat lists (also you would be automatically added to theirs).

How Do You Create a Kik Profile?
Once you have downloaded and installed the Kik Messenger app as we explained in the introduction to this article, you will need to follow these simple steps in order to set up your Kik profile. This operation should not take you more than a few minutes at most.
- Grab the smart phone or mobile device where you have downloaded and installed the Kik Messenger app.
- Locate the Kik Messenger app and launch it by tapping on it.
- Tap on the “sign up” icon on your screen.
- Entered your preferred user name. Remember that this user name must be unique to you so choose something either extremely original or extremely random. You user name should not give out any clues as to your real identity for your privacy and security. You may not be able to choose the first thing that you come up for as your user name. If that is the case keep trying with slight variations on your original idea or totally different user names.
- Once you have chosen a user name that nobody else is using, choose your display name. Your display name is made up of a first and last name. You can use your real name or come up with something. Remember that your display name will be shown on the screen of anybody chatting to you, so consider if you could have any issues with this. Also, you would be able to change your display name as many times as necessary even after you set up your profile. There is no limit on how many times you change it.
- Now that you have chosen the all important user and display names, you would have to enter your email address. Make sure that you enter an email address that is valid and that you have (and will continue to have access to). This is really important because you will not be able to activate your Kik account until you have activated the email that you would receive from Kik Messenger after setting up your profile). Once you have successfully created your account, you would be able to change your email address if necessary. If you ever change your email address you should immediately update your Kik settings. This would prevent any potential future problems accessing your account.
- The last piece of personal information you need to enter would be your date of birth. If you were under 13 years of age your profile would be rejected; if you are between the ages of 13 and 18 you will be asked for parental permission (or permission from a legal guardian) in order to set up your profile. If you are 18 years old or older, you will be able to complete the signing up process.
- Once you have entered all the required personal information, you will be asked to pass a CAPTCH test. This is done so that your identity as a human being can be verified also in order to prevent spam bots from joining the app and bug real users like you.
You would also have the option to enter a profile picture. You can use any picture that you like.
Just to clarify the only information other Kik Messenger users will see would be your display and user names, and your profile picture. Your age and email address will not be divulged as they are merely used to confirm your identity and set up your account.
